Lisply MCP

This project is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) adapter used to connect large language models (LLMs) with the Lisp development environment, supporting interaction through the lightweight Lisply protocol. The main functions include Lisp code evaluation, HTTP requests, and debugging support, suitable for scenarios such as AI-assisted symbolic programming and CAD design automation.

Main Features

Ping Check
Test whether the Lisp backend is running normally.
Lisp Code Evaluation
Execute arbitrary code directly in the Lisp environment.
HTTP Request
Call the API of the Lisp backend through the HTTP interface.
File Management
Upload, download, and operate on files.
